Repairs

Report a repair to our After Care team by calling 020 7974 6617.

Emergencies: if your repair is an emergency please call 020 7974 4444. Examples include leaks which can’t be contained and repairs which are a risk to health and safety or security.

We will attend as soon as reasonably possible to repair the following: Communal heating and hot water systems; lifts; door entry systems; and failure of lighting on landings and staircases. Our repair responsibilities are available on this page. 

Home safety and fire safety advice

Security doors and grilles: You must not fit security doors or grilles or carry out any other alterations to your home without our written permission.

Smoke alarms: Remember to change the battery according to the instructions and clean the inside at least once a year with a vacuum cleaner. Test smoke alarms every week.

Keep communal areas and escape routes clear: Please do not let clutter collect in passages and stairways as this is a fire risk. The storage of personal belongings – including bicycles and push chairs – in shared areas could prevent you and others getting out safely.

If you have large items to dispose of, find out how to do this at camden.gov.uk/recycling or call 020 7974 4444 (select option 4). For more information: www.london-fire.gov.uk

Lodgers and subletting 

A lodger is someone who rents a furnished room in your home. They have use of the
bathroom and kitchen, but do not have sole use of any part of your home. Your tenancy agreement says that we must agree before any new adults move into your home so you must ask your housing officer if you want a lodger.
